The USP (United States Pharmacopeia) Cleanroom Airborne Microbial Testing service is a critical component in ensuring the quality and safety of pharmaceutical products. This testing ensures that airborne microbial levels within cleanrooms are within acceptable limits as defined by USP guidelines, thereby safeguarding the integrity of the manufacturing process.

Cleanrooms play a pivotal role in pharmaceutical production because they minimize contamination risks during the manufacturing of high-quality products. The air quality inside these controlled environments must meet stringent standards to prevent any microbial contaminants from affecting product purity and efficacy. USP Cleanroom Airborne Microbial Testing is essential for compliance with these regulations, ensuring that the environment remains free from harmful microorganisms.

The testing process involves collecting airborne particles using various sampling methods, which are then analyzed in a laboratory setting to determine the presence of viable microbes. This method ensures accurate quantification and identification of potential contaminants. Frequently Asked Questions

What types of samples are collected during USP Cleanroom Airborne Microbial Testing?
During testing, air samples are typically collected using settle plates or impaction samplers. These devices capture airborne particles over a set period, allowing for subsequent analysis under controlled conditions.
How often should cleanrooms undergo USP Cleanroom Airborne Microbial Testing?
Frequency depends on the specific requirements of the facility and its operations. However, it is generally recommended that testing be conducted at least once every three months to ensure ongoing compliance.
Can this service also help detect particulate matter in addition to microbial contaminants?
Yes, many of the same sampling techniques used for microbial testing can be adapted to measure particulate matter. This dual capability ensures comprehensive environmental monitoring.
